Bio- By Karen Cahill I am 58 and I was born in England, but my parents emigrated to NZ when I was 9. I went through school and Teacher’s College in Christchurch, NZ and taught elementary school for a few years before heading overseas. I lived for 4 years in Japan and 4 years in Seoul Korea (teaching English) before settling in the US. I have traveled extensively and loved living in, and learning about other cultures. I currently live right outside Atlanta, Georgia and work in the advertising and marketing industry. I have one grown son who lives in Chicago, and I am lucky enough to have my mum and sister live 3 minutes away from me. My extended family is in the US and the UK, but I am still in touch with friends I have made all over the world.
